Guidelines for Speakers
Oral presentations are 25 minutes long (for survey papers) and 9 minutes long (for regular papers). Paper presenters will be expected to report to their session chair before the start of the session in which their paper is presented, and also contact the organizers for special requirements. A computer with PowerPoint and overhead projector will be available. You can also use your own laptop computer.

Policy about parallel submissions to ICDAR03 and GREC03
We invite the submission of original, previously unpublished work. We also welcome, with some restrictions, submissions which are closely related to work submitted also to this year's ICDAR. Please use our workshop to present work that differs materially from your ICDAR presentations, in any of several ways:
